The History of Boston Radio
Boston's radio history dates back to the early 20th century when the city became a pioneer in broadcasting technology. The first experimental radio station in Boston, 1XE, began transmitting in 1919, marking the beginning of a rich tradition of radio broadcasting in the city. Over the years, Boston radio has evolved from simple news broadcasts to a diverse array of programming that includes music, sports, talk shows, and more.
Throughout its history, Boston radio has played a critical role in shaping the cultural landscape of the city. Stations like WBZ, one of the oldest continuously operating radio stations in the United States, have provided listeners with a steady stream of news, weather updates, and entertainment. Understanding AM and FM Radio in Boston
When discussing Boston radio, it's essential to understand the difference between AM and FM radio. AM (Amplitude Modulation) radio typically broadcasts on lower frequencies and is known for its ability to travel long distances, especially at night. FM (Frequency Modulation) radio, on the other hand, operates on higher frequencies and offers better sound quality, making it ideal for music and entertainment programming.
In Boston, both AM and FM stations coexist, catering to different audiences. While AM stations often focus on news, talk, and sports, FM stations are more popular for music and entertainment. Popular Boston Radio Stations
Boston boasts a wide range of popular radio stations that cater to diverse interests. From classic rock to contemporary hits, sports updates to political talk shows, there's something for everyone. Below are some of the most popular Boston radio stations:
Top Boston Radio Stations
- WBZ-FM: Known for its mix of classic rock and current hits.
- WEEI: A leading sports radio station in Boston, covering the Red Sox, Patriots, Celtics, and Bruins.
- WBUR: A public radio station offering news, talk, and cultural programming.
- 98.5 The Sports Hub: The go-to station for Boston sports fans.
- WGBH: A public radio station focusing on classical music and educational content.
